Clearance Required: TS/SCI w/ Full Scope Polygraph

Other Requirements: U.S. Citizenship

Description: Provides expertise in integrating, installing, configuring, upgrading, compiling, and supporting COTS/GOTS software in a heterogeneous operating system environment.


The Level III Software Integration Engineer (SIE) shall possess the following capabilities:

Ability to integrate, install, configure, upgrade, compile, and support COTS/GOTS software.

Generate documentation for the full software stack.

Update software for sustainment support.

Basic Linux system administration skills and shell scripting.

Execute test codes for characterization of software performance.

Provide software product ownership for HPC tools.

Working knowledge of CM tools, web documentation, and issue tracking.

Ability to work in a fast paced environment and switch between various architectural paradigms.

Basic Qualifications:

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science or related field and have at least eight (8) years of demonstrable experience with integrating, installing, configuring, upgrading, compiling, and supporting COTS/GOTS software in a heterogeneous operating system environment.

OR

The individual shall have five (5) years full time Computer Science directly related work that can be substituted for a degree and have at least eight (8) years of demonstrable experience.

OR

An industry recognized professional certification, as defined in the TT0s, may substitute as one (1) year experience. A Master's Degree in Computer Science or related field may substitute for two (2) years' experience

Experience as a Linux System Administrator with technical knowledge regarding compute, network, memory, and storage components

Experience writing scripts using Bash

Experience diagnosing system issues on Linux-based clusters


Experience with SLURM Workload Manager


Experience with HPC open source parallel programming methods such as OpenSHMEM, pthreads, Open MPI, and UPC

Recommended Qualifications

Experience with automating system procedures/tasks and using benchmarks to confirm subsystem health

Experience with Linux cluster/node monitoring tools such as NHC (Node Health Check)

Familiar with InfiniBand network communications

Familiar with parallel file systems such as Lustre

Experience with the Atlassian Suite of Tools (Jira, Confluence, Bitbucket)
